SUMMARY

To evaluate the effect of deep brain stimulation (DBS) vs best medical treatment in essential tremor (ET) in a randomized, single-blinded controlled trial.

View:

• Diagnosis of ET, as decided by the movement disorder specialist; Substantial incapacity; Duration of symptoms \> 5 years; Age 18 - 75; unsatisfying effect from β-blockers, or be unable to tolerate the medical therapy.
